Comments: A man, Renfield, is traveling to Castle Dracula. The weather is difficult, so the coach stops in the town below the castle. The man manages to find his way to his personal carriage and continues on to the castle. What he finds isn't much to his liking. Neither is the Count's plan for him, and they start a journey to England. Can Dracula be stopped?

This pre-Code film is derived from the 1924 adaptation for the stage, and has been preserved by the Library of Congress. The DVD transfer looks good today, despite the film being an early "talkie".

I found it funny that armadillos existed in eastern Europe. Perhaps they were placed because they are unusual? Another oddity for modern folks who know geography is the peasants praying in Hungarian. Transylvania wasn't always part of Romania. In 1931, Transylvania was part of the Kingdom of Hungaria.

Bela Lugosi defines Dracula: shadowy, sinister, and seductive. His performance is outstanding. This film is classic horror without the gore.
